Creating a Strong Communication Plan: Tips for Staying Connected Despite the Distance.

Creating a strong communication plan is essential for surviving a long-distance relationship when your boyfriend lives in another country.

Whether you’re a seasoned veteran of long-distance relationships or just starting out, maintaining open and frequent communication is key to keeping your bond strong despite the miles between you.

First and foremost, it’s important to establish a communication routine that works for both of you. This can be anything from a daily text message to a weekly video call, but it’s crucial that you both agree on the frequency and type of communication that you’ll engage in.

Make sure to be flexible and understanding of each other’s schedules and time differences.

Another important aspect of staying connected is being mindful of the way you communicate.

When you can’t physically be together, it’s easy for miscommunications and misunderstandings to arise.

Try to be clear and direct in your communication, and always listen actively to what your partner has to say.

In addition to traditional forms of communication like texting and video calls, consider incorporating other methods to stay connected.

Sending care packages, writing love letters, and sharing music or videos that remind you of each other can be great ways to show your love and maintain a strong emotional connection.

Finally, it’s important to remember that communication is a two-way street. Make sure to actively listen to your partner’s needs and concerns, and be honest and open with them about your own.

Trust is a vital component of any relationship, and being honest and transparent with each other will help to build and maintain that trust over time.

While the distance between you and your boyfriend may be challenging, creating a strong communication plan can help to bridge that gap and keep your relationship thriving.

By establishing a routine, being mindful of the way you communicate, and actively listening to each other’s needs, you’ll be well on your way to surviving the distance and building a lasting, meaningful relationship.

Managing Time Differences: How to Find Time for Your Relationship Despite Busy Schedules.

Managing time differences can be one of the most challenging aspects of a long-distance relationship when your boyfriend lives in another country. Juggling busy schedules and conflicting time zones can make it difficult to find quality time to connect and maintain your relationship. H

owever, with a little bit of creativity and flexibility, it is possible to make the most of the time you do have together.

One strategy for managing time differences is to schedule your communication in advance.

Make a plan to set aside a specific time each week for a video call or virtual date night, and stick to it as much as possible. This will help to ensure that you both have something to look forward to and will reduce the stress of trying to coordinate schedules on the fly.

Another strategy is to find creative ways to stay connected throughout the day. This can include sending quick text messages throughout the day to check in and share updates, or using shared calendars to keep track of each other’s schedules and availability.

It’s also important to be flexible and understanding when it comes to scheduling.

Recognize that both of your schedules will have their own demands and constraints, and be willing to make adjustments and compromises as needed. This may mean waking up early or staying up late to accommodate time differences, or being flexible with plans in order to make time for each other.

In the end, the key to managing time differences in a long-distance relationship is to prioritize your relationship and make the most of the time you have together.

By communicating openly and regularly, finding creative ways to stay connected throughout the day, and being flexible and understanding with each other’s schedules, you can make your relationship thrive despite the distance.

Navigating Cultural Differences: Embracing Diversity and Learning from Each Other.

When your boyfriend lives in another country, navigating cultural differences can be both exciting and challenging.

Differences in language, customs, and traditions can be a source of richness and excitement in your relationship, but they can also lead to misunderstandings and miscommunications.

However, with an open mind and a willingness to learn and embrace diversity, you can navigate cultural differences and build a stronger, more meaningful relationship.

One strategy for navigating cultural differences is to approach them with curiosity and an open mind.

Rather than viewing differences as obstacles to overcome, try to see them as opportunities to learn and grow. Ask your partner questions about their culture and traditions, and be willing to share your own.

This will not only help you to better understand and appreciate each other’s backgrounds, but it will also deepen your connection and strengthen your relationship.

Another strategy is to be respectful of each other’s cultural differences. Recognize that what may be acceptable or normal in one culture may not be in another, and be willing to adapt and adjust as needed.

This may mean learning basic phrases in your partner’s language or adjusting your behavior in social situations to avoid unintentionally offending anyone.

Finally, it’s important to approach cultural differences with a sense of humor and humility. Recognize that misunderstandings and miscommunications will inevitably occur, and be willing to laugh at yourselves and learn from your mistakes.

Navigating cultural differences in a long-distance relationship can be challenging, but it can also be an opportunity for growth and enrichment.

By approaching differences with curiosity and respect, and maintaining a sense of humor and humility, you can build a stronger, more resilient relationship that embraces diversity and celebrates the richness of different cultures.

Keeping the Romance Alive: Creative Ways to Surprise and Show Your Love from Afar.

When your boyfriend lives in another country, keeping the romance alive can be a challenge.

The distance between you can make it difficult to maintain the spark and excitement of a new relationship, and finding creative ways to show your love and appreciation can feel like an uphill battle.

However, with a little bit of effort and creativity, it is possible to keep the romance alive and show your partner how much you care from afar.

One strategy for keeping the romance alive is to surprise your partner with thoughtful gestures and gifts.

This could include sending a care package filled with their favorite snacks or a handwritten love letter in the mail or organizing a surprise virtual date night complete with candles, music, and their favorite meal.

Another strategy is to make an effort to keep your connection strong and intimate despite the distance. This could include scheduling regular video calls or phone dates, sending flirty text messages throughout the day, or even playing online games together to stay connected and engaged.

Finally, it’s important to find creative ways to show your love and appreciation for your partner from afar. This could include making a photo collage of your favorite memories together, sending a personalized playlist of songs that remind you of them, or even sending a surprise bouquet of flowers to their doorstep.

Keeping the romance alive in a long-distance relationship takes effort and creativity, but it is possible.

By surprising your partner with thoughtful gestures and gifts, staying connected and intimate despite the distance, and finding creative ways to show your love and appreciation from afar, you can keep the spark alive and build a stronger, more resilient relationship that can survive the distance.

Dealing with the Emotional Rollercoaster: Coping Strategies for the Tough Times of Long-Distance Relationships.

When your boyfriend lives in another country, the emotional rollercoaster of a long-distance relationship can be overwhelming. The ups and downs of missing each other, dealing with time differences, and limited communication can take a toll on your emotional well-being.

However, with a few coping strategies, you can navigate the tough times and come out even stronger on the other side.

One strategy for coping with the emotional rollercoaster is to set realistic expectations and communicate openly with your partner.

Talk about your feelings and concerns, and be honest about the challenges you are facing. This can help to alleviate some of the stress and anxiety of the unknown and make it easier to manage your emotions.

Another strategy is to focus on self-care and maintaining a healthy mindset. This could include exercising regularly, getting enough sleep, practicing mindfulness and meditation, and seeking support from friends and family when needed.

It’s also important to find ways to stay positive and focus on the good aspects of your relationship. This could include reminiscing on your favorite memories together, planning future visits, and setting goals for the future of your relationship.

Finally, it’s important to stay connected and engaged with your partner despite the distance. This could include scheduling regular video calls or phone dates, sending care packages or handwritten letters, and finding creative ways to show your love and appreciation for each other from afar.

Dealing with the emotional rollercoaster of a long-distance relationship can be tough, but it is possible.

By setting realistic expectations and communicating openly with your partner, focusing on self-care and maintaining a healthy mindset, staying positive and engaged, and finding creative ways to stay connected, you can navigate the tough times and come out even stronger on the other side.
